2.91M

Диплом

1.

2026
Разработка мобильного приложения со встроенной
системой лояльности (на примере Кофе365)
Выполнил: студент группы 22ИСП5-о9 Игнатюк Александр
Калининград
РАНХиГС
Научный руководитель: Соловьева Ю. А.

2.

2
Актуальность
Зависимость от стороннего сервиса
Ограниченный функционал
Упущенная выручка
Низкая возвращаемость
2026

3.

3
Цель исследования
Цель проекта:
Разработать мобильное приложение со встроенной системой
лояльности для кофейни «Кофе365», обеспечивающее
повышение среднего чека, удержание клиентов и
автоматизацию маркетинговых акций.
2026

4.

4
Задачи исследования
Изучить текущие проблемы и существующие решения в этой сфере.
Проанализировать процессы ипользования системами лояльности.
Разработать удобный и понятный интерфейс
Провести тестирование системы
2026

5.

5
Объект и предмет разработки
Объект разработки
процесс взаимодействия кофейни «Кофе365» с
клиентами через программу лояльности.
Предмет разработки
программный инструмент (мобильное
приложение), управляющий клиентским
поведением за счёт динамических механик
вознаграждения.
2026

6.

6
Стек технологий
Flutter
UI-инструментарий Google для нативных
приложений из одной кодовой базы
FastAPI
Современный Python-фреймворк для быстрого
создания REST API с авто-документацией.
PostgreSQL
Свободная реляционная СУБД с расширенной
функциональностью и расширяемостью.
2026
Компилируется в нативный ARM-код, собственный
движок рендеринга Skia, горячая перезагрузка, богатые
виджеты Material Design.
Высокая производительность за счёт асинхронности,
встроенная валидация через Pydantic, автоматическая
генерация OpenAPI и Swagger.
Поддерживает JSON, полнотекстовый поиск, ACID,
репликацию. Расширяется пользовательскими типами,
функциями и расширениями.

7.

7
Разработка интерфейса –
основные страницы приложения
2026

8.

8
Разработка интерфейса –
основные страницы приложения
2026

9.

9
Разработка интерфейса –
Профиль пользователя и создание команды
2026

10.

10
Тестирование приложения –
Профиль пользователя и создание команды
Через TestClient (встроенный HTTP-клиент FastAPI на
базе httpx) были протестированы полноценные
сценарии работы пользователя без запуска реального
сервера
Вся ключевая бизнес-логика покрыта модульными
тестами с использованием фреймворка pytest.
⸻Тестирование интерфейса проводилось на реальном
Android-устройстве.
В процессе выявлены недочёты в UX и валидации, и
были исправлены.
2026

11.

11
9
Заключение
Разработано мобильное приложение, превращающее пассивный 5% кэшбек в инструмент
управления продажами: мотивирует пробовать новинки, покупать чаще и больше, сокращает
списание просрочки — шаг к более эффективному и независимому бизнесу.
Чему я научился в ходе проекта:
• Проектировать и разрабатывать мобильное приложение с нуля на современном стеке.
• Организовывать взаимодействие клиента и сервера через REST API и управлять
состоянием приложения.
• Учитывать реальные потребности бизнеса и конечных пользователей при
проектировании интерфейса и механик лояльности.
• Реализовывать гибкую бизнес-логику с динамическими правилами начисления бонусов
и проектировать базу данных под неё.
2026

12.

2026
Калининград
РАНХиГС
СПАСИБО ЗА ВНИМАНИЕ!
English     Русский Rules